Transaction 75177363386141c6ca9ab632baa9ffed923e3a481eba4f6fc0748767fd9d5b15
1 Input
1 Output
-
75177363386141c6ca9ab632baa9ffed923e3a481eba4f6fc0748767fd9d5b15:0
- value
- 11571978
- script pubkey
- OP_0 OP_PUSHBYTES_20 d90e25b7060ce5cac39fca7e929982f541676a33
- address
- bc1qmy8ztdcxpnju4suleflf9xvz74qkw63nx6mr4a